首页
/ Aliyunpan Docker版实时同步速度显示问题解析

Aliyunpan Docker版实时同步速度显示问题解析

2025-06-12 18:37:33作者:滕妙奇

阿里云盘命令行工具Aliyunpan的Docker版本在文件同步过程中默认不显示实时传输速度,这给用户监控同步进度带来了不便。本文将深入分析该问题的技术背景及解决方案。

问题现象

当用户使用Aliyunpan的Docker容器进行文件同步时,控制台输出仅显示同步的文件列表,而不会像download命令那样展示实时传输速度(如1.69MB/s)。这种差异导致用户无法直观了解当前同步的进度和网络状况。

技术背景

Aliyunpan工具在标准命令行模式下会通过进度条组件实时计算并显示传输速度,这一功能依赖于:

  1. 文件传输过程中的字节数统计
  2. 时间间隔计算
  3. 终端控制字符的实时更新

而在Docker环境中,由于以下原因可能导致该功能受限:

  • 容器化环境的输出缓冲机制
  • 日志收集系统的处理方式
  • 终端交互特性的限制

解决方案

根据项目维护者的确认,该问题已在V0.3.0版本中得到解决。升级到该版本后,Docker容器中的同步操作将能够正常显示实时传输速度。

对于无法立即升级的用户,可考虑以下替代方案:

  1. 通过外部监控工具观察网络流量
  2. 分析同步日志的时间戳计算平均速度
  3. 使用docker stats命令监控容器资源使用情况

最佳实践建议

  1. 定期更新到最新版本以获取完整功能
  2. 对于大文件同步,建议结合日志和时间戳进行速度估算
  3. 在性能敏感场景下,考虑使用非容器化部署以获得更完整的终端交互体验

该问题的解决体现了开源项目持续迭代优化的特点,用户应及时关注版本更新以获取最佳使用体验。

登录后查看全文
热门项目推荐
相关项目推荐